🌞 Free Summer Meals for Kids! 🍎🥪
Pocahontas County Schools is proud to sponsor the federally funded Summer Food Service Program, ensuring that no child goes hungry while school is out!
📍 Meal Sites:
Marlinton Elementary School
906 5th St, Marlinton, WV 24954
Green Bank Elementary/Middle School
5917 Potomac Highlands Trail, Green Bank, WV 24944
🕗 Meal Times (Monday–Friday):
🍽️ Breakfast: 8:00 AM – 8:30 AM
🍽️ Lunch: 11:30 AM – 12:00 PM
📅 Program Dates: June 16 – July 30, 2025
❌ Closed: June 19–20 & July 4
👧👦 Open to all children 18 and under
Because Hunger Doesn’t Take a Summer Vacation 💪
📞 For more info, contact Julie Dunlap at 304-799-4505 ext. 2223

On Tuesday, May 6th, PCHS is hosting our first Course Fair! To assist students in requesting courses for the 2025-2026 school year, they will meet with teachers in each of our six departments to learn more about CTE programs, electives, honors and dual credit courses.
On Thursday, May 8th, students will receive a program of study and course request form to complete a preliminary course request. Once students submit their request, parents will have an opportunity to schedule a meeting with their student's advisor to review their Personalized Education Plan.
Thank you for your continued participation and support in your child's education!
